Early Life and Rise to Stardom
Born Michael James Hucknall on June 8, 1960, in Denton, Greater Manchester, Mick grew up as an only child. His early life wasn’t easy—his mother left the family when he was just three, a experience that later inspired the hit “Holding Back the Years.”
Before Simply Red, Mick fronted the punk band Frantic Elevators. But it was in 1985, with the formation of Simply Red, that everything changed. Their debut album Picture Book launched them into global stardom, thanks to smooth soul-pop tracks that resonated across generations.

Sources of Mick Hucknall’s Wealth
Mick’s fortune comes from more than just music. While album sales and tours formed the core, he diversified early.
Simply Red’s commercial peak in the 1980s and 1990s generated massive royalties. As the primary songwriter, Mick benefits from ongoing publishing income. Even today, streaming and sync licensing (music in ads, films, and TV) continue to add value.
Beyond music, Hucknall made strategic investments:
- Co-ownership in Ask Property Development, focusing on urban projects
- Ownership of a vineyard in Sicily, producing “Il Cantante” wines
- Past ventures like restaurants and other hospitality projects

Personal Life and Lifestyle
At 65 years old, Mick Hucknall maintains a relatively private life despite his public persona. He married Gabriella Wesberry in 2010 in a beautiful Scottish castle ceremony. The couple shares a daughter, Romy True, born in 2007.
Mick has spoken openly about family priorities, stepping back from constant touring to focus on home life. He splits time between England and his Sicilian vineyard, enjoying a balanced mix of creativity and relaxation.
